Upon discussing the album, Wiley said: "I came to a point in my life where I realized that hadto actually evolve and I was just trying to put myself to the test, and make a real album that I would make. I used to do things and not finish them. This time around I actually did concentration from the start. If something wasn't right, I went back and I said, 'Wiley, this isn’t right.' Not to say on the other lbumsI didn’t work hard, but it’s just that this time I actually did concentrate, and it’s probably the first time I ever have."
